Another scenario where you have nexus in a state and have to collect sales tax is if you’ve made over $100,000 or 200+ transactions in that state. The fact that you’re dropshipping in multiple states doesn’t mean that you have nexus in all of them. In most cases, dropshippers have nexus only in the state they have a physical presence (business, warehouse, employees).

There are several ways to establish sales tax nexus with a state, but the two most common are through physical presence (physical nexus) or economic activity (economic nexus). Resale exemption certificate procedures vary from state to state. A supplier’s sale to a seller is usually an exempt wholesale transaction because the seller is purchasing the goods to resell them. The issue with this line of thinking is that California does not accept resale certificates from out of state. Instead, California requires the retailer to register in California and obtain a California resale certificate.

Each state in America has its own sales tax rates, which is set up by the government of that state. For example, the sales tax rate in Louisiane is 9.98% (of the retail price of your products/services) while it’s only 1.69% in Alaska. There are some states where the sales tax rates are zero, such as Delaware, Oregon, New Hampshire, and Montana. These states are often considered as “tax havens” as you don’t have to pay taxes there.
